pe系统是哪里
PE系统是微软开发的预安装环境,用于系统维护、安装及故障排除的临时操作系统。
PE系统是哪里?
PE系统(Preinstallation Environment,预安装环境)是一种轻量级的操作系统环境,主要用于计算机系统的安装、部署、故障排查和数据恢复等场景,它最早由微软开发,作为Windows操作系统家族的一部分,但其设计理念和应用范围已扩展到更广泛的领域,要理解PE系统的“来源”,需要从技术发展、应用场景及生态系统等多个角度展开分析。
PE系统的起源与发展
PE系统的核心概念源于操作系统部署与维护的需求,在Windows NT时代,微软意识到需要一种独立于主操作系统的工具环境,以应对系统崩溃、病毒攻击或硬件故障等问题,2002年,微软首次推出Windows PE 1.0,作为Windows XP部署工具的一部分,其设计目标是为企业IT团队提供一个可引导的临时环境,用于安装操作系统、执行硬件诊断或修复启动问题。
Windows PE的主要版本演进
版本 | 发布时间 | 支持的Windows系统 | 核心改进 |
---|---|---|---|
Windows PE 1.0 | 2002年 | Windows XP | 首次发布,基于NT内核,支持基础命令行工具 |
Windows PE 2.0 | 2007年 | Windows Vista | 支持图形界面(有限)、更广泛的硬件驱动 |
Windows PE 3.0 | 2009年 | Windows 7 | 增强网络功能、支持PowerShell脚本 |
Windows PE 5.0 | 2012年 | Windows 8 | UEFI启动支持、存储空间管理优化 |
Windows PE 10 | 2015年至今 | Windows 10/11 | 安全性提升、兼容现代硬件(如NVMe SSD) |
这一演进过程表明,PE系统的功能逐渐从简单的安装工具演变为综合性的维护平台,Windows PE 5.0开始支持UEFI启动模式,适应了现代计算机硬件的变革。
PE系统的核心功能与应用场景
PE系统的核心价值在于其“独立性”——它可以直接从U盘、光盘或网络启动,无需依赖本地硬盘的操作系统,以下是其典型应用场景:
-
操作系统部署
- 企业环境中批量安装Windows系统。
- 通过脚本自动化完成分区、驱动注入和系统配置(如使用DISM工具)。
-
系统修复与恢复
- 修复引导记录(BCD)、恢复损坏的系统文件。
- 运行
chkdsk
检测磁盘错误,或使用sfc /scannow
修复系统文件。
-
数据救援
- 当主系统无法启动时,通过PE环境访问硬盘数据。
- 结合工具如
TestDisk
或Recuva
恢复误删文件。
-
病毒查杀与安全检测
- 在脱机环境下运行杀毒软件(如360急救箱、卡巴斯基应急磁盘)。
- 清除顽固病毒或Rootkit程序。
-
硬件诊断
运行内存测试工具(MemTest86)或硬盘健康检测(CrystalDiskInfo)。
PE系统的技术架构
从技术角度看,PE系统基于Windows内核(NT内核),但经过高度精简,以下是其关键组件:
组件 | 功能描述 |
---|---|
引导加载程序 | 支持Legacy BIOS和UEFI模式,从外部介质加载内核 |
最小化Win32子系统 | 提供基础API支持,允许运行32/64位应用程序 |
驱动程序库 | 包含常见存储控制器、网络适配器的驱动,确保硬件兼容性 |
命令行工具 | 集成diskpart 、bcdedit 等系统管理工具 |
可选图形界面 | 部分PE版本提供资源管理器界面,方便用户操作 |
一个典型的Windows PE 10镜像大小约为300MB,但可通过添加自定义驱动或工具扩展功能。
PE系统的获取与定制
官方渠道
微软通过Windows评估和部署工具包(ADK)提供PE系统的构建工具,用户需要下载ADK并选择“部署工具”和“Windows预安装环境”组件,通过命令行生成基础PE镜像。
第三方修改版
由于官方PE功能有限,技术社区开发了增强版PE系统,
- 微PE工具箱:集成常用维护工具(如Ghost、分区助手)。
- Hiren's BootCD PE:整合数据恢复、密码重置等实用程序。
自定义流程
用户可通过以下步骤创建个性化PE:
- 使用ADK生成基础镜像。
- 挂载WIM文件,添加第三方工具(如7-Zip、Notepad++)。
- 注入特定硬件驱动(如RAID控制器)。
- 重新打包为ISO或可启动U盘。
PE系统与其他维护环境的对比
特性 | Windows PE | Linux Live CD | 专用救援设备(如PC-3000) |
---|---|---|---|
启动速度 | 较快(15-30秒) | 中等(30-60秒) | 慢(依赖硬件连接) |
硬件兼容性 | 依赖驱动完整性 | 开源驱动覆盖广 | 针对性硬件支持 |
数据恢复能力 | 依赖第三方工具 | 内置工具丰富 | 专业级恢复功能 |
学习成本 | 需熟悉Windows命令 | 需掌握Linux基础 | 高(需专业培训) |
典型用途 | 系统部署、基础修复 | 跨平台维护、开发 | 硬件级故障修复 |
PE系统的未来趋势
- 云集成:现代PE系统开始支持从云端加载工具脚本,例如通过Azure云服务获取最新病毒库。
- 安全性增强:随着Secure Boot和TPM芯片的普及,PE环境需适配硬件级安全协议。
- 容器化工具:通过轻量级容器(如Docker)在PE中快速部署特定维护环境。
相关问答(FAQs)
Q1:使用第三方修改的PE系统是否合法?
微软官方PE系统需通过ADK合法获取,且仅允许用于授权的Windows副本部署,第三方修改版可能涉及软件许可问题,例如集成的商业工具(如Acronis True Image)需独立授权,用户应确保遵守当地版权法规。
Q2:PE系统能否替代日常使用的操作系统?
不能,PE系统设计为临时环境,缺少持久化存储支持、多用户管理和高级图形功能,长时间运行可能导致内存耗尽或不稳定,日常使用仍需完整版Windows/Linux系统。
版权声明:本文由 芯智百科 发布,如需转载请注明出处。